The Happy News: Greg Gutfeld Welcomes Baby Daughter, Mira
To the delight of many and perhaps the surprise of some, Greg Gutfeld, at the age of 60, became a father. The announcement was made by his “The Five” co-host, Dana Perino, on Tuesday, December 10th, putting all speculation to rest.
Perino shared a statement from Gutfeld himself, revealing the joyous news: “It is with great joy that my wife Elena and I have welcomed a baby girl into the world. Mira is healthy with a real set of lungs. She has Elena’s beautiful eyes and my rock-hard abs. We are hard at work teaching her three languages and putting her through rigorous workout routines. She is already very observant and has asked if Jesse wears a toupee. I told her that he definitely wears a wig.”
This heartwarming news explained Gutfeld’s absence and showcased his characteristic humor even in personal announcements.

Co-hosts’ Reactions: Congratulations and Joking Banter
Gutfeld’s “The Five” co-hosts reacted to the news with a mix of congratulations and playful banter, reflecting their on-screen camaraderie.
Dana Perino, who delivered the announcement, stated, “We are there in spirit. Just not changing diapers,” expressing support while humorously drawing a line at parental duties.
Jesse Watters, known for his own witty remarks, added, “We are enjoying the time without you. Take as long as you want,” in jest, highlighting the show’s dynamic and the team’s lighthearted approach to Gutfeld’s temporary leave.
Who is Elena Moussa, Greg Gutfeld’s Wife?
Greg Gutfeld is married to Elena Moussa, a stylist in the fashion industry. The couple’s story is quite romantic; they met in Portugal in 2004 and married just five months later, according to reports from People magazine. Elena Moussa is 42 years old and originally from Russia.
The couple also shares their life with a dog named Gus, who even made a cameo in Gutfeld’s statement about his newborn daughter.
In his statement read by Perino, Gutfeld concluded, “As you can understand, we value our privacy and we thank everyone for the good wishes. And now I have to go stop Gus from licking her face,” emphasizing their desire for privacy while sharing a relatable moment of new parenthood.
